Output 05ba9a91a3353b9f2bf4a6c90377f84c37d0da007662a66a8aebe09cfd5c8dda:20

value
28697814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ee7bd630163317a434a4257b2d97470b4cf62afd955439fad46d623cf862061b
address
bc1paeaavvqkxvt6gd9yy4ajm968pdx0v2haj42rn7k5d43re7rzqcdsyelueq
transaction
05ba9a91a3353b9f2bf4a6c90377f84c37d0da007662a66a8aebe09cfd5c8dda
spent
true